How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ration Actually Works

The process of restoring ceiling drywall after water damage is much more than just wiping up a puddle. It requires a systematic approach to completely remove moisture, dry out materials, and prevent secondary issues like mold and structural decay. When you try to handle this yourself, it’s easy to miss hidden moisture, which can fester and cause problems down the line. Our systematic approach ensures every affected area is addressed thoroughly. We utilize specialized equipment designed for this exact purpose, unlike general home tools.

1. Emergency Water Extraction and Containment

Our first priority is to stop the water source if possible and remove standing water from your ceiling and any affected areas below. We use powerful extraction units to remove bulk water quickly. This step is critical to prevent further saturation and spread. It typically takes a few hours, depending on the volume of water.

2. Moisture Detection and Assessment

Once visible water is gone, we use advanced mo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to identify exactly how far the water has penetrated the drywall, insulation, and framing. This is essential for accurate damage mapping. We need to know the full extent of the problem, which can take several hours to complete.

3. Controlled Drying Process

We set up industrial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ers to create an environment that promotes rapid evaporation. These machines work tirelessly to dry out saturated materials effectively. This stage can last anywhere from one to several days, depending on the severity of the water intrusion and the building materials involved.

4. Mold Prevention and Remediation

As we dry, we also apply EPA-approved antimicrobial treatments to prevent mold growth on affected surfaces. If mold is already present, our certified technicians will safely remove and remediate it. Preventing mold is key to a healthy home. This is an ongoing process throughout the drying phase.

5. Repair and Restoration

Once everything is completely dry and any mold issues are resolved, we can begin the repair process. This typically involves replacing damaged drywall, repainting, and ensuring the ceiling is restored to its pre-loss condition. We aim for invisible, lasting repairs. This final stage can take several days to a week or more, depending on the scope of repairs.

Warning Signs You Need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ration

Catching ceiling water damage early is your best defense against more extensive and costly repairs. Many homeowners overlook subtle signs, thinking they’re minor issues. However, these early indicators can signal a much larger problem brewing within your walls and ceiling structure. Addressing these signs promptly can save you significant headaches and expense later on.

Discolored Spots or Stains

Yellow or brown stains on your ceiling are a clear sign of water intrusion. The discoloration comes from minerals and contaminants in the water. Don’t just paint over them; this indicates a leak that needs fixing and the underlying drywall may be compromised.

Sagging or Bulging Drywall

When drywall becomes saturated, it loses its structural integrity and can start to sag downwards. This is a serious indicator that the material is holding a significant amount of water. Immediate attention is required to prevent a collapse.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ent damp, musty smell, especially in rooms directly below the ceiling, is a strong sign of hidden moisture and potential mold growth. Even if you can’t see a visible leak, the smell tells a story. Investigate these odors to prevent health issues.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int

Water trapped behind paint layers will cause them to bubble up or peel away from the drywall surface. This is another visual cue that moisture is present and damaging the finish. This is a clear warning that the drywall is absorbing water.

Dripping Water

This is the most obvious and urgent sign. If you see water actively dripping from your ceiling, it means the drywall has become saturated and is likely failing. Act immediately to prevent water damage to your belongings and flooring below.

Water Rings

Similar to stains, water rings are concentric circles left behind by repeated or prolonged water exposure. They are a tell-tale sign that a leak has been present, even if it’s intermittent. These rings indicate saturation and potential structural weakening.

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small, fresh drip stain (less than 1 foot diameter) with no sagging Yes, monitor closely Yes, for a thorough assessment Hidden moisture can still cause problems; professionals have detection tools.
Large, dark stains or multiple stains on the ceiling No Yes Indicates significant saturation and potential structural compromise.
Visible sagging or bulging of the drywall Absolutely Not Yes High risk of ceiling collapse; requires immediate professional intervention.
Musty odors emanating from the ceiling area No Yes Suggests hidden moisture and the beginnings of mold growth.
Water actively dripping from the ceiling No Yes Emergency situation requiring rapid extraction and drying.
Suspected leak from plumbing or roof issues No Yes The source of the leak must be repaired before restoration can begin.

While minor, fresh water spots might seem manageable, any sign of significant saturation, sagging, or persistent odors warrants professional attention.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ration Cost In Carmel Valley, CA

The cost for ceiling drywall water damage restoration in Carmel Valley, CA, can vary quite a bit. Several factors influence the final price, including the size of the affected area, the extent of the water damage, and whether mold is involved. These figures are estimates and a precise quote requires an on-site inspection.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Moisture Assessment and Detection $300 – $800 The complexity of the ceiling structure and the extent of suspected damage.
Water Extraction (Minor to Moderate) $500 – $2,000 The volume of standing water and the accessibility of the area.
Controlled Drying (Air Movers & Dehumidifiers) $700 – $3,000+ The duration required to dry the materials, which depends on saturation levels.
Antimicrobial Treatment / Mold Prevention $200 – $700 The square footage needing treatment and the type of product used.
Drywall Repair and Replacement $400 – $1,500+ (per sheet) The number of drywall sheets needing replacement and the complexity of the repair.
Painting and Finishing $300 – $1,000+ The size of the area to be repainted and the number of coats required.

Common Questions About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ration

What if I just paint over the water stain?

Painting over a water stain without addressing the underlying issue is a temporary fix at best. The moisture will continue to degrade the drywall, potentially leading to mold growth and structural weakness. Our team ensures the drywall is completely dry and the source of the leak is resolved before any cosmetic repairs are made, preventing future problems.

How long does it take to dry out a wet ceiling?

The drying process can vary significantly, typically taking anywhere from one to several days. Factors like the amount of water intrusion, the type of insulation, and ambient humidity all play a role. Our technicians use specialized equipment to accelerate drying and monitor progress closely to get your home back to normal as quickly as possible.

Is ceiling water damage a health hazard?

Yes, it can be. Wet drywall and insulation create an ideal environment for mold and mildew to grow, which can release spores into your air. Inhaling these spores can cause respiratory problems and allergic reactions. We take mold prevention and remediation very seriously during our restoration process.

What kind of equipment do you use to dry my ceiling?

We utilize professional-grade equipment such as high-speed air movers to circulate air and promote evaporation, and powerful dehumidifiers to extract moisture from the air. We also use advanced mo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to accurately assess moisture levels and ensure complete drying. This specialized equipment is far more effective than household fans.

Can I prevent ceiling water damage in Carmel Valley, CA?

While not all water damage is preventable, you can significantly reduce the risk. Regularly inspect your roof for damage, check plumbing in attics or above ceilings for leaks, and ensure your HVAC system is properly maintained. Promptly addressing any minor leaks or condensation issues can save you from major ceiling damage down the road.
